Principal Job Description

We are seeking a seasoned education leader to assume the role of Principal at our school. As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for driving academic excellence and fostering a positive school culture.

The successful candidate will have a proven track record of success in leading small schools and have a deep understanding of NESA registration and accreditation requirements. They will also possess excellent organisational skills, strong communication abilities, and a commitment to the philosophy of Christian education.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and implement educational programs that align with our values and mission
  • Maintain a safe and inclusive learning environment
  • Build strong relationships with staff, students, and parents
  • Manage school operations and resources effectively
Requirements
  • Master's degree in Education or related field
  • Minimum 5 years of experience as a Principal or senior educator
  • Proven ability to lead and manage change
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
What We Offer

We offer a competitive salary package, including housing on site for non-local residents. Our school is committed to providing a supportive and collaborative work environment that fosters growth and development.

In addition to your remuneration, you will have the opportunity to work with a dedicated team of educators who share your passion for Christian education. You will also have access to ongoing professional development opportunities to support your growth as an educator.
